Appreciation dinner held for volunteer firefighters that assisted in Lee County recovery

  • Source: WZDX-TV Huntsville
  • Published: 03/25/2019 07:41 PM

First responders risk their lives to protect you and me, and they do it with seldom recognition. One church is showing their appreciation to several volunteer fire departments who helped with tornado recovery in Lee county. Firefighters with the Hazel Green Volunteer Fire Department were part of crews from across North Alabama that assisted with recovery efforts, after deadly tornadoes ripped through Lee county. "I don't know how to put it in words. It's something that you don't expect to see, but every area sees it at some point," said Danielle Watson with Hazel Volunteer Fire Department. First responders say helping others in crisis is something they're passionate about, especially for volunteers who don't get paid to do it.
